Pediatrix Medical Group is seeking an experienced board-certified Pediatric Intensivist to join our pediatric inpatient and critical care team at Summerville Medical Center (SMC), just 30 minutes from Charleston, South Carolina.

About the Role

  • 6-bed PICU
  • Level III NICU support
  • Telephone consult available with quaternary care center 45 minutes away
  • Inpatient pediatric floor + ER consults
  • In-house days, home call at night
  • Teaching opportunities: a family medicine residency program is now in its third year with residents participating about half of the year, 4.5 days per week
  • Procedures include: intubations, LPs, line/chest tube placement, CPR
  • 2024 Census: 373 pediatric admits, 85 PICU admits, ADC: 4.1

About Summerville Medical Center

  • 124-bed acute-care hospital with South Carolina’s busiest Pediatric ER (19K+ visits in 2024)
  • 24-hour emergency room and comprehensive medical services
  • A growing Women’s & Children’s service line
  • “Home-like” birthing suites and advanced surgical services
  • Surgical services include orthopedic, reflux, robotic, and weight loss surgeries

About Us

Pediatrix Medical Group is one of the nation’s leading providers of highly specialized healthcare for women, babies, and children. Since 1979, Pediatrix has grown from a single neonatology practice to a national, multispecialty medical group. Pediatrix-affiliated clinicians provide coordinated, compassionate, and clinically excellent services across the continuum of care, both in hospital settings and office-based practices.
